Frequently Asked Questions about Worthville
What type of rentals are currently available in Worthville?
There are currently 51 Apartments for Rent in Worthville, PA with pricing that ranges from $420 to $2,895. There are also 40 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Worthville ranging from $530 to $3,475.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Worthville?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Worthville ranges from $530 to $3,475 with an average monthly rent of $1,293.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Worthville?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Worthville range from $430 to $2,494,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$775 to $3,450.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$750 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$420.
